¿Cuánto cuesta alquilar un apartamento en College Point?
| Dormitorios | Precio Promedio | Más barato | Más caro |
|---|---|---|---|
| Apartamentos Estudio en College Point | $4,799 | $4,799 | $4,799 |
| Apartamentos 1 Dormitorios en College Point | $2,511 | $1,800 | $3,200 |
| Apartamentos 2 Dormitorios en College Point | $3,164 | $2,200 | $6,000 |
| Apartamentos 3 Dormitorios en College Point | $3,313 | $2,850 | $3,800 |
| Apartamentos 4 Dormitorios en College Point | $4,300 | $4,300 | $4,300 |
